Q: How do I check why FeedSentinel flagged a podcast feed?

A: FeedSentinel validates RSS structure, enclosure sizes, and episode GUID uniqueness. Most flags come from duplicate GUIDs after a CMS migration. Re-run validation after fixing; results refresh within five minutes. The complete rule list, severity levels, and override process are documented on the internal page below.

runbook for badug-kadup: https://confluence.zemvarlabs.internal/projects/browse/display/projects/bd1b

## Runbook: Releasing the Pinloft Address Autocomplete Widget

Before publishing a new widget build, confirm the suggestion index snapshot matches the target region set, and run the fixture suite against the Harwick staging gateway. Do not skip the locale fallback checks; past regressions came from missing district-level data. Once the build passes, it must be signed before the CDN publisher will accept it — unsigned bundles are silently dropped, which has burned maintainers before. Sign the artifact with the deploy key shown below.

rollout seal: bky19_M1Zvn1YQwEBTy4XxP3H

## Further reading

Vexhook retries failed webhook deliveries with exponential backoff, capped at eight attempts over 24 hours. Signatures are recomputed per attempt; replayed payloads carry a fresh nonce. Receivers must treat duplicate event IDs as idempotent. For the threat model, signing key rotation schedule, and retry-window edge cases, see the internal page linked below.

wiki page, fahaf-yagag: https://confluence.qorvellabs.internal/pages/display/pages/display

Ticket: Signature verification failed for shared component library @hollowgrove/ui-core v4.2.0 during the nightly Brindlework pipeline run. Root cause appears to be a version mismatch: the lockfile pinned v4.1.9 while the registry served v4.2.0 signed after last week's rotation, so the verifier still held the retired key. Please purge the cached trust store on the build agents, re-pin the lockfile to v4.2.0, and update the verifier to trust the current deploy key, which is listed below for reference.

rollout seal: bky9_PeXH1fTLY